It runs in three environments: sandbox, staging, and production. Sandbox resets nightly and is safe for experiments. Staging mirrors production topology but points at the synthetic traffic generator, so percentage rollouts behave realistically. Production changes require a second approver from the Corewright team. Each environment has its own evaluation cache and SDK key scope, so flags never leak across boundaries. New joiners usually start by reading the staging setup, which runs with the following values.

service settings:
PRAIX_LOG_LEVEL=error
PRAIX_METRICS_HOST=metrics.praix.qorvelcorp.corp
PRAIX_POOL_SIZE=16

Handover — Vexler partner SFTP drop

Ownership moves to you today. Drop runs hourly from Vexler's end into the intake bucket via the relay host. Watch for zero-byte files; their exporter flakes on Mondays. Creds live in the ops vault, path noted in the runbook. Vault auto-seals after 48h idle. Support escalations go to the on-call rotation, not me. If the vault is sealed when you need it, unseal with the recovery passphrase below.

recovery phrase for tadug-fafof: zorwyn-kasion

TICKET-2290: Intermittent connection failures during template rendering on Plumeria. Under load, the render workers exhaust the connection pool because each template fetch opens a fresh session instead of reusing one; upstream then refuses new connections. Security note for review: pooling fix requires credentials to move from per-worker config into the shared vault path. No data exposure observed. The affected workers currently connect using the string below.

primary connection of fahag-kawig = mysql://gilath_svc:ycU1T0imceeaI4@db-27dd.norvastack.example:5432/silwyn